The idea that an election for the president of Iran would be honestly held is an absurdity. That nation has one man who controls every aspect of life there. He is Ayatollah Ali Khamenei. In terms of constitutional authority, Mr. Khamenei is plainly the most powerful man in the Islamic Republic; no decision can be made without his consent. It is Mr. Khamenei who will decide the person to be president of Iran. In the unlikely situation that the elected president makes no difference to him, then the results will be reported honestly.
